GroEL and the GroEL-GroES Complex

Sub-cellular biochemistry, 2017
Chaperonin is categorized as a molecular chaperone and mediates the formation of the native conformation of proteins by first preventing folding during synthesis or membrane translocation and subsequently by mediating the step-wise ATP-dependent release that result in proper folding.
